Overall, these benefits underscore the importance of incorporating regular tree trimming into landscape care.How Arborists Evaluate Tree Health for TrimmingIn what way do arborists assess the condition of a tree before trimming? Their evaluation starts consult now with a visual inspection, concentrating on the tree's overall structure, leaf condition, and any indicators of illness or pest infestation. Tree specialists inspect the trunk for splits, decay, or lesions, which can suggest deep-seated health issues. They also check the root network to ensure firmness and adequate nutrient absorption.Subsequently, they examine the tree's age and species, as different types have specific growth patterns and needs. Arborists analyze environmental factors, such as soil quality, light exposure, and surrounding vegetation, which can affect tree health.At last, they may leverage tools such as soil tests or bark probes to gain deeper insights. This detailed assessment allows arborists to make informed decisions about trimming, making certain each cut supports the tree's wellness and extended life while elevating the overall landscape.
Common Tree Trimming Techniques You Should KnowTree trimming utilizes various techniques designed to promote vitality and aesthetic appeal. One common method is crown thinning, which includes selectively removing branches to improve light penetration and air circulation within the tree. This technique enhances overall health while preserving the tree's natural shape. Another typical approach is crown reduction, used to lower the height of a tree while preserving its structure. This is particularly beneficial for trees that present a risk to nearby structures. Additionally, the technique of deadwooding focuses on eliminating dead or diseased branches, stopping the spread of pests and diseases. Finally, directional pruning promotes growth in specific directions, allowing for better landscape design and avoiding obstructions.
